October 2023 Spam Update
Wednesday, October 4, 2023
We're releasing an update to our spam detections systems
today that will improve our coverage in many languages and spam types.
This spam update aims to clean up several types of spam
that our community members reported in Turkish, Vietnamese, Indonesian, Hindi, Chinese, and other languages.
We expect this to reduce the visible spam in search results, particularly when it comes to cloaking,
hacked, auto-generated, and scraped spam. The update will take a few weeks to roll out.
Sites that see a change after a spam update should review our spam policies.
